The History of KungFu from a Fan's perspective

 History of KungFu The History of KungFu is more than just a fighting style where techniques and stuff are used.

KungFu is a way of life with the general meaning being 'accomplished person’ or ‘mastery through time and effort’.

Practicing KungFu teaches discipline, as well as health, patience, and self knowing.

Its roots can be traced to China in late 2000 BC under Emperor Huang Ti where early martial art methods were used mainly for defensive purposes and fighting strategies.

Around 600 BC, when Confucianism and Taoism emerged, those monks used Cong Fu / Go Ti methods to learn how to be more balanced in their daily lives.

From what I’ve learned around 520 AD, Bodhi Dharma was the one who first brought martial arts to the Shaolin Temple.

His purpose was so that the monks would have more energy and would be able to perform their daily tasks and studies a lot more efficiently.

The Shaolin monks didn’t have a lot of physical energy and were falling asleep during lectures and meditation classes.

Another reason the Shaolin monks learned KungFu was because they needed to protect themselves from bandits and government officials.

A good depiction of this is represented in the Shaw Brothers Kung Fu film "36th Chamber of Shaolin" .

As time went on as the Shaolin monks were learning KungFu martial arts which were inspired by nature, they went into a deeper study of nature’s creatures such as Tiger, Snake, Dragon, Leopard, Monkey, Praying Mantis, and Crane.

This is a quick review of the History of KungFu.
